Singer Buble says life changed after son’s cancer diagnosis

Singer Michael Buble, who releases his new album “Love” next month, has spoken about putting his career on hold after his son Noah was diagnosed with liver cancer.

“When you experience something that my family has experienced, it has to change you,” he told Reuters on Tuesday.

The Canadian singer announced in November 2016 that his oldest son Noah, who was three at the time, had been diagnosed with cancer and was undergoing treatment.

The 43-year-old singer, who released his new single “Love You Anymore,” written by Charlie Puth, a few days ago, was humble about his experiences.

The singer recently dismissed reports published in the Daily Mail that he was retiring from music.

Buble’s new album “Love” goes on sale on Nov. 16.
